JUDGMENT
[Judgment of the Court was delivered by M.DURAISWAMY,J.] Challenging the order passed in W.P.(MD)No.17291 of 2014, dated 12.12.2019, the writ petitioner has filed the above Writ Appeal. The appellant filed the writ petition in W.P.(MD)No.17291 of 201 to issue a Writ of Certiorarified Mandamus to call for the records relating to the impugned order of the first respondent dated 16.09.2013 and quash the same and consequently directing the first respondent to appoint him as Revenue Assistant in the BC-GL priority category in pursuance to the certificate verification held on 18.07.2013.
2. It is the case of the appellant that he registered with the Employment Exchange prior to the third respondent and therefore, he should have been selected in the place of the third respondent.
3. The learned Single Judge, taking into consideration the case of both parties, dismissed the writ petition finding that merely because the petitioner as a senior candidate in the Employment Exchange in registration, cannot be given any priority in selection to the post. Further the selection was conducted only on merit basis and the Selection Committee found the third respondent more suitable for the post than the petitioner. In these circumstances, the learned Single Judge rightly dismissed the writ petition. We do not find any error or irregularity in the orde passed by the learned Single Judge. The Writ Appeal is devoid of merits and the same is dismissed. There shall be no order as to costs.
